Another issue that is common to an inoperable ignition switch is the difficulty in getting your car started. When you turn on the ignition, the switch is able to transfer power to the starter and other electrical components. Without this power source, your car won't start and your accessories might not function properly. When you replace the ignition switch, you'll need to take off the steering column so that you can reach the ignition switch.

The ignition switch in your car is a critical component. When it fails, it can cause your car to stall in traffic, or even not shut off when the key is removed. It may be costly to replace this component but the savings will be worth it. If you notice any of these symptoms, it is important to replace the ignition switch.

A malfunctioning ignition switch could cause a variety of car issues. Besides affecting your car's ability to start, a damaged ignition switch could cause numerous other issues with the electrical system of your car. You may not be allowed to use your power windows and radio until the ignition switch has been repaired.

The wrong ignition switches can cause the engine to stop right after it starts. The ignition switch is responsible for delivering energy to the starter motor along with ignition components as well as other components of the car. If the ignition switch fails it could be because the battery is dead or that there is a blockage in the electrical pathway. This can cause your car to not start at all and you'll need to contact an expert.
